In a nutshell:
Pros for vista 64 bit:
*Takes better advantage of multi-core processors
*Slightly faster when dealing with large calculations
*Allows you to go paste 4 GB RAM
Cons for 64 bit Vista:
*Some software are not compatible on 64 bit platforms

Very little software is incompatible with 64-bit. Typically, programs which operate deep within the system, like security programs will have issues and must be 64-bit. Games and most end-user applications will work normally. However, there are some exceptions, like PGP, that specifically block itself from installing on a 64-bit OS. If a program has been developed to take advantage of 64-bit instruction sets and memory allotments, it will be faster than a 32-bit counterpart.
